Avila Beach continues to develop
From the outside, most believe that Avila Beach is built out. But a proposed development looks to be moving forward with the Harbor District, called Harbor Terrace.
The Harbor Terrace is being developed to be a coastal camping resort for both locals and tourists alike as an outdoor community gathering place surrounded by scenic ocean views. This development will be owned and run by the Harbor District.
The Harbor District vision states the following amenities:
102 RV locations
50 tent sites
25 tent cabins / domes
A main lodge
Restaurant (locally owned and operated)
Market deli café (offering local food and wine)
Harbor related uses
With the recent Port San Luis resident’s eviction notice, things appear to be moving ahead for future development. GMB Realty Partners is currently named as a possible Joint Development Partner. GMB Realty Partners estimates that the total project cost will be approximately $13,000,000 $15,000,000.
When the actual development will happen is anyone’s guess, with the state of our economy, the Harbor District will have its challenges for sure.
